Output 0639c4fa19061d5692df7530aeae102c91a4081719b58f498307abee9e3d0b0e:6

value
136037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d42ae89c5f6459cee43acec8b11170a2b9ad0a OP_EQUAL
address
3BLb3MFrHw3sZ2FjoBo86CPyBy6RVfer8W
transaction
0639c4fa19061d5692df7530aeae102c91a4081719b58f498307abee9e3d0b0e
spent
true